ADD65 - DUERGAR
Sculpted by Alan & Michael Perry. Painted by Richard Scott and Sascha Herm.
These figures represent Duergar, evil dark-dwarves who haunt the endless tunnels of the Underdark. They were sold in packs of 3 miniatures which included a crossbowman, a Duergar armed with a military pick, and one wielding a warhammer. There are 5 variants of each pose, with the only differences being in head position and facial features.
Pose 1
![]()
Pose 1, variant A. This Duergar wears a short-sleeved chainmail shirt and high leather boots. He carries various items of equipment on his back, including a battleaxe, a sheathed shortsword and a quiver of bolts for the heavy crossbow he carries in his right hand. This particular variant wears a conical helmet adorned with large, round studs and a top-spike. He has shoulder-length hair, a long, straight beard, but no moustache, and is looking to his right with his mouth closed.
![]()
Pose 1, variant B. This variant is bare-headed. He has short hair, and is beardless but has a stubbly chin. He is looking slightly to his right with his partly open in an evil grin.
![]()
Pose 1, variant C. This Duergar variant wears a plain, conical helmet with a large fur edging. He has shoulder-length hair, a long, straight beard, but no moustache, and is looking to his left with his mouth closed.
![]()
Pose 1, variant D. This variant wears a tall, studded leather cap. He has long hair protruding from beneath his cap, but is beardless. He is looking slightly to his right with his mouth closed.
![]()
Pose 1, variant E. This figure is bare-headed and has short hair with 3 long braids at the back. He has a long beard which has been gathered into 2 forked braids, and is looking to his left and slightly upwards with his mouth closed.
Pose 2
![]()
Pose 2, variant A. This Duergar wears an ornate, leather-edged chainmail hauberk, leather leggings and boots with steel toe-caps. He wears a sheathed shortsword at his left hip and wields a single-handed military pick in his right hand high above his head. This particular variant wears a round steel helmet with a studded rim and cheekguards. He has shoulder-length hair, and a long, flowing beard and moustache, and is looking slightly to his right with his mouth open wide as if shouting.
![]()
Pose 2, variant B. This variant wears a round steel helmet with several large, round bosses decorating it. He has shoulder-length, braided hair, and a long, braided beard (in the style of the ancient Babylonians) but no moustache, and is looking slightly to his right with his mouth open wide as if shouting.
![]()
Pose 2, variant C. This particular variant wears a plain, battered conical steel helmet with a long chainmail neckguard. He is clean-shaven, and is looking straight forwards with his mouth closed.
![]()
Pose 2, variant D. This Duergar variant is bare-headed, revealing a bizarre hairstyle! It is flat on top, but stands out stiffly from his head in a disc-shape. His long beard is styled to match. He is looking straight forwards with his mouth open wide as if shouting.
![]()
Pose 2, variant E. This variant wears a tall, studded leather cap. He has long hair protruding from beneath his cap, and has a long, straight beard and moustache. He is looking straight forwards, with his lips slightly apart, as if talking out of the corner of his mouth.
Pose 3
![]()
Pose 3, variant A. This Duergar warrior wears a leather-edged chainmail hauberk, leather and fur leggings and leather boots. He wears a sheathed shortsword at his left hip and wields a single-handed warhammer in his right hand level with his waist. This particular variant is bare-headed, revealing an impressive, tall mohican-style haircut with a long ponytail. He has a long beard and moustache, and wears a nose-ring and 2 rings in his right ear. He is looking slightly to his right with his mouth open in a snarl.
![]()
Pose 3, variant B. This figure wears a steel helmet with a rivetted rim and cross-band, decorated with 2 long horns. He has shoulder-length hair, and his long beard has been gathered into 2 forked braids. He is looking to his front with a grimacing look on his face.
![]()
Pose 3, variant C. This figure wears an ornate, viking-style steel helmet adorned with an eagle's head crest. He has shoulder-length hair, and a long beard but no moustache. He is looking sharply to his right with his mouth open in a shout.
![]()
Pose 3, variant D. This figure is bare-headed and has short hair, a short beard and no moustache. He is looking to his front with his mouth slightly open.
![]()
Pose 3, variant E. This figure wears an ornate, conical steel helmet with a nasal, several studs, a top-spike, cheek-guards and a banded neck-guard. He has shoulder-length hair, and a long, thin beard but no moustache. He is looking sharply to his right with his mouth closed.
